THIS is the chilling moment a pilot is wished “good luck” dealing with aliens after spotting a “silver canister” UFO just ...
Leland Melvin claims he came across the object - which NASA said was a piece of ice - while he was working on the Space Shuttle Atlantis A NASA astronaut has claimed he once saw an “alien-like, ...
The TV star has spotted 'strange lights' over his home in the village of Adlington, in Kent Want all the latest Showbiz news direct to your inbox? Share your email for news, gossip and more We have ...